OSHA's regulation for the control of hazardous energy, 1910.147, is called the "Lockout/ Tagout" regulation. Specifically, this regulation covers "the servicing and maintenance of machines and equipment in which the unexpected reenergization or start up of the machine or equipment, or the unexpected release of stored energy could cause injury to employees." The regulation mandates a minimum performance level for controlling this hazardous energy.
